I think we ran our 35 people through for about $1500, it might've been even less. A good way to bolster the training argument, take an interested, technically inclined user and put them on 2010 ahead of time (set their saving to compatibility mode). Chances are they'll confirm that training would be helpful. Also, you mention legal environment, do you mean law office? Billable hours?
